The Siemens Virtual Client disrupts this cycle. It is a software-based simulation environment—often built upon the foundation of or integrated within the TIA Portal and NX Mechatronics Concept Designer —that acts as a stand-in for physical hardware.

For example, if a factory manager wants to increase line speed by 10%, they can test the impact on the Virtual Client first. Will the cooling fans keep up? Will the material handling robots collide? The Virtual Client answers these questions without disrupting the live production flow. I recommend the Siemens Virtual Client to: This

Now I will write the article. concept of a "virtual client" encompasses a broad range of technologies, and for a global industrial giant like Siemens, it represents a fundamental pillar of its digitalization strategy. Rather than a single product, Siemens offers a comprehensive ecosystem of virtualization technologies designed to separate software from specific hardware. This approach empowers businesses to run critical applications, from advanced engineering tools to process control systems, on centralized servers, delivering them to users on demand. This shift is revolutionizing industrial operations by driving unprecedented levels of efficiency, flexibility, and security.

Operators use rugged SIMATIC Industrial Thin Clients on the plant floor. These units contain no moving parts (fans or hard drives), making them highly resistant to dust, vibration, and extreme temperatures. Business and Operational Benefits
